Dacheng Old Journal Full-text Database

By Susan Xue, UC Berkeley, Resource Liaison for Dacheng Journals All UC campuses; on the Dacheng platform http://uclibs.org/PID/241770 This collection of old journals contains more than 7,000 journal titles and 130,000 issues published in China from the late Qing Dynasty to 1949.  […]

CDL and Partners Receive Sloan Funding to Enhance DMPTool Features; Reach Out to Community

By Carly Strasser, Data Curation Specialist The California Digital Library and its partners were awarded a $590,000 grant from the Alfred P. Sloan Foundation to fund further development of the popular Data Management Planning Tool (DMPTool) in 2013.  The bulk […]
